Software Engineer, Instrument Control Test Automation

Location
Menlo Park, CA, United States
Posted
Jun 10, 2021
Ref
2222
Hotbed
Biotech Bay
Required Education
Bachelors Degree
Position Type
Full time
Software Engineer, Instrument Control Test Automation 

Y ou'll be responsible for leading the develop ment and maint enance of automated tests for our DNA sequencer platforms. This position reports to the Manager for Instrument Software Engineering and you'll work closely with the development team as well as across departments to coordinate integration tests and validation.

Skills & Experience Needed
  • Agile development with current functional, integration, end-to-end testing principles, practices and tools
  • Test automation using APIs and UI test tools
  • Embedded systems, IoT or life science instrumentation
  • Test automation for robotics, device control and simulation of hardware devices
  • Experience with Linux-based systems

Your Role Includes: 
  • Expand tests, hardware simulators and simulated end-to-end tests for multiple DNA sequencer platforms. Maintain a fast development cadence while building multiple software platforms at once.
  • Improve automation performance and increase code analysis coverage.
  • Develop team metrics and reporting for product quality, testing and performance.
  • Coach and support the team on best-practice approaches to functional and unit testing along with developing and improving the test platform. 
  • Develop a BDD test framework and tests in C# and leverage Python integration for further automation. 
  • Collaborate with other software teams to create integrated automation platforms.
  • Track work in Jira and X-Ray and trigger automation with Bamboo or similar.


Key Qualifications
  • Understanding of automation strategy and frameworks 
  • Experience with the entire test cycle – from test design and authoring to execution, debugging and log analysis, as well as reporting
  • Fluency in C# or a similar, high-level language.
  • Broad and deep experience in best practices for quality and testing, with a drive to keep learning more and growing.
  • Computer Science or related discipline BS/MS/PhD or equivalent experience.



Pacific Biosciences (NASDAQ: PACB) is planning to cure disease with comprehensive genomics, from improving human health to aiding all forms of biology and microbiology. In particular, our technology is being used for most COVID-19 pandemic surveillance to track mutations and virulence. Join the team and have a significant impact on human well-being and build a collective understanding of the biological world.

All listed tasks and responsibilities are deemed as essential functions to this position; however, business conditions may require reasonable accommodations for additional tasks and responsibilities.

All qualified applicants will receive consideration for employment without regard to race, sex, color, religion, national origin, protected veteran status, or on the basis of disability, gender identity, and sexual orientation.